Transaction ff9075eb5259548808c449ef33d862ee4465eb1f55b34e9b89e0864f47d561ce
1 Input
2 Outputs
- ff9075eb5259548808c449ef33d862ee4465eb1f55b34e9b89e0864f47d561ce:0
- ff9075eb5259548808c449ef33d862ee4465eb1f55b34e9b89e0864f47d561ce:1
value 29500459
address 1H2WHouagc9DEJ2x5wJ9rxpZhi7awzwT5m
value 101663172
address 12MZiEUwUVCxbbeNin11RBMDtjsGjXpXZV